The Opportunity Shape Something Different – Join our Energy subsector, a vital part of WSP’s ERI (Energy, Resources & Industry) sector, delivering solutions that power Canada’s energy transition. From upstream and downstream oil and gas to renewable energy markets, we partner with clients across the full project lifecycle—designing, engineering, and innovating for a low-carbon future. Are you ready to help shape the infrastructure that fuels communities today—and transforms how we power tomorrow? As a Senior Electrical Engineer on our Energy team , you’ll join a powerhouse group of innovators, problem‑solvers, and world‑builders who thrive on tackling complex challenges across renewable energy, power generation, and energy‑modernization projects. Here, your expertise won’t just support projects— it will energize entire systems and play a key role in building resilient, future‑ready solutions that advance our clients’ missions and strengthen the communities we serve. This position can be located in any of our Canadian offices, with preference for our BC and AB locations. Your Impact • Deliver senior‑level electrical engineering for medium and large projects within the energy and power generation sector; everything from design basis development, equipment selection, detailed design, and field implementation. • Lead client and stakeholder engagement to clarify needs, define scope, and ensure alignment through all project phases. • Guide multidisciplinary coordination to support cost control, scheduling, procurement, reporting, and construction support activities. • Develop feasibility studies, technical reports, and conceptual design packages. • Review, stamp, and approve drawings and documents while ensuring compliance with codes, standards, and client requirements. • Specify equipment from first principles and apply simulation tools and internal engineering models. • Mentor and coach junior engineers and designers, building a collaborative learning environment. • Manage scope, schedule, change control, and deliverables in alignment with project execution plans. • Uphold and promote corporate and client procedures, contributing to quality, safety, and continuous improvement. • Provide senior support on negotiation of critical engineering issues and contribute to proposal development. The Skills That Set You Apart • University degree in Electrical Engineering and active P.Eng registration within your province of practice. • At least 10+ years of EPCM electrical engineering experience within the energy and power generation sectors. • Proven success in a Lead Engineer capacity, guiding teams through complex project execution. • Strong technical depth across electrical systems design, field operations, and engineering analysis tools. • Ability to independently manage projects, drive outcomes, and support multi‑discipline collaboration. • A passion for developing others and contributing to a high‑performance engineering culture.
